Log:
  Provide fix for sigbus on ARM caused by unaligned access.
  
  PR:		200053
  Submitted by:	mikael.urankar@gmail.com, usenet@ulrich-grey.de

Added: head/mail/sylpheed/files/patch-libsylph_procmsg.c
==============================================================================
--- /dev/null	00:00:00 1970	(empty, because file is newly added)
+++ head/mail/sylpheed/files/patch-libsylph_procmsg.c	Mon Jul  6 07:14:29 2015	(r391392)
@@ -0,0 +1,20 @@
+--- libsylph/procmsg.c.orig	2014-06-10 04:06:35 UTC
++++ libsylph/procmsg.c
+@@ -164,7 +164,7 @@ static gint procmsg_read_cache_data_str_
+ 	if (endp - *p < sizeof(len))
+ 		return -1;
+ 
+-	len = *(const guint32 *)(*p);
++	memcpy(&len, *p, sizeof(len));
+ 	*p += sizeof(len);
+ 	if (len > G_MAXINT || len > endp - *p)
+ 		return -1;
+@@ -197,7 +197,7 @@ static gint procmsg_read_cache_data_str_
+ 		g_mapped_file_free(mapfile);			\
+ 		return NULL;					\
+ 	} else {						\
+-		n = *(const guint32 *)p;			\
++		memcpy(&n, p, sizeof(n));			\
+ 		p += sizeof(guint32);				\
+ 	}							\
+ }
